The spellbinding new Robert Langdon novel from the author of The Da Vinci Code. Fans will not be disappointed The Times Robert Langdon, Harvard professor of symbology and religious iconology, arrives at the Guggenheim Museum Bilbao to attend the unveiling of a discovery that will change the face of science forever. The evenings host is his friend and former student, Edmond Kirsch, a fortyyearold tech magnate whose dazzling inventions and audacious predictions have made him a controversial figure around the world. This evening is to be no exception: he claims he will reveal an astonishing scientific breakthrough to challenge the fundamentals of human existence. But Langdon and several hundred other guests are left reeling when the meticulously orchestrated evening is blown apart before Kirschs precious discovery can be revealed.
